New findings in ultrasound-induced adsorption of acousto-responsive microgels
Interdisciplinary research provides deeper insight into the behavior of ultrasound-activated soft particles and lays the foundation for new applications
2024/01/08 by Sonja Wismath

In collaboration with our research partners from the Institute of Condensed Matter Physics, we are evaluating the behavior of characteristic variables such as interfacial tension and adsorption at water-oil interfaces under the influence of acoustic streaming. This is induced by ultrasound and influences the behavior of the soft particles on a molecular level. The results offer possibilities in various fields ranging from pharmacology to the food industry.
